One of America's most recognizable and beautiful folk tunes, Shenandoah had by the mid-ninteenth century achieved wide popularity on both land and sea.American folklorist Alan Lomax suggested that Shenandoah was a sea-shanty and that the composers likely were French-Canadian voyageurs traveling down the Missouri River — men who sought their fortunes as trappers and traders, loners who became friendly with and sometimes married Native American women. American sailors heading down the Mississippi River picked up the song and made it a capstan shanty — a work song — that they sang while hauling in the anchor.Various versions of the song, and various lyrics to the tune, exist. Some believe that the song refers to the Shenandoah river. Others suggest that it is of Native American origin and tells the tale of Sally, the daughter of an Algonquin Indian chief, Shenandoah, who is courted for seven years by a white Missouri river trader. Other versions of the song have linked it to riverboat men, cavalry men, mountain men, and Civil War soldiers. Ask your choristers to bring their guitars, ukuleles, mandolins, and banjos and strum along!Conceived using the SA(T)B concept (http://www.dandavisonmusic.com/what-is-satb.html) and also available in Two-Part Treble and Unison voicings, Git Along Little Dogies is a traditional American cowboy ballad.  The melody and lyrics were first published in 1910 in John Lomax's Cowboy Songs and Other Frontier Ballads, though the song has existed long before publication in the anonymous aural tradition of folk music. Since selling cattle was quite profitable, a crew of cowboys drove a herd, particularly from Texas, to railheads where they would be loaded into railcars and shipped cross-country to get the best price at market. Cowboys watched the cattle 24 hours a day, herding them in the proper direction in the daytime and watching them at night to prevent stampedes and deter theft.  Around the campfire, cowboys sang of life on the trail with all the challenges, hardships, and dangers encountered along the way.E. C. Teddy Blue Abbott, honored in the Montana Cowboy Hall of Fame, explains The singing was supposed to soothe the cattle and it did... The two men on guard would circle around with their horses on a walk, if it was a clear night and the cattle was bedded down and quiet, and one man would sing a verse of a song, and his partner on the other side of the herd would sing another verse; and you'd go through a whole song that way.Notable performances: 2016 Idaho Middle School All-State Choir, inaugural year | 2016 Northshore 6th Grade Honor Choir, boys2017 Choral Contest EntryLaurie Betts Hughes, ASCAP | www.LaurieBettsHughes.com

Goodnight, Irene or Irene, Goodnight is a 19th century song written and published as Goodnight, Irene in 1886 by Gussie Lord Davis an African American songwriter. The song (by then much altered) was first recorded (and claimed) in 1932 by American musician Huddie Leadbelly Ledbetter.  The lyrics tell of the singer's troubled past with his love, Irene, and express his sadness and frustration.This true piece of musical Americana is scored for 4-part SATB ensemble with piano accompaniment.  It makes for a great program closer, or audience participation number.  Performance time: c.3:00+.
